Q: Is 5,413,028 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 5,413,028 is not a prime number.

Why is 5,413,028 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 5413028 can be evenly divided by 1 2 4 1,353,257 2,706,514 and 5,413,028, with no remainder.

Since 5,413,028 cannot be divided by just 1 and 5,413,028, it is not a prime number.
